Voltage Strategy: Arc Flash Mitigation

  • Why do engineers rarely specify 3000 kVA at 400V? It is not just about cable thickness; it is about safety.
  • At 400V, this unit pushes over 4300 Amps. In the event of a fault, the Arc Flash Incident Energy at the low-voltage terminals would be massive, posing a lethal risk to maintenance personnel even with PPE.
  • Therefore, this cast resin distribution transformer is typically configured for 690V or 3.3kV/6.6kV outputs. By stepping up the secondary voltage, we reduce the rated current (e.g., down to ~260A at 6.6kV). This drastically lowers the potential fault energy, allowing for the use of standard, safer switchgear protection ratings without requiring specialized high-power breakers.

Advanced Casting: Internal Cooling Ducts

  • Scaling up to a cast resin dry type transformer of this size introduces a critical thermal challenge: getting heat out of the deep layers of the winding. A solid block of resin is a poor thermal conductor.
  • To solve this, the 3000 kVA coils are not cast as a solid cylinder. Instead, the design uses Internal Cooling Ducts. During the casting process, specialized molds create vertical air channels inside the high-voltage winding itself. This geometry splits the coil into concentric segments, doubling the surface area available for heat exchange. This ensures that the core temperature remains uniform, preventing "hot spots" that degrade insulation life.

Compliance: IEC 60076-11 Routine Tests

  • Reliability at 3 MVA is non-negotiable. Every unit undergoes a rigorous quality gate strictly adhering to iec 60076 11.

  • Partial Discharge (PD) Verification: Unlike oil units, dry transformers cannot self-heal. We conduct the induced AC voltage withstand test with PD measurement. The acceptance criterion is stricter than the standard: we mandate ≤ 10 pC at 1.3 times the rated voltage.
  • Impulse Testing: To verify the winding's ability to withstand grid switching surges, the unit is subjected to a Lightning Impulse test (e.g., 75 kV or 95 kV peak), ensuring the resin structure does not flashover under transient stress.

Typical Application Context

  • Marine Propulsion: Installed inside the hull of electric ferries to power 690V propulsion motors. The self-extinguishing resin is mandatory for maritime safety compliance (DNV/Lloyd's standards).
  • Underground Mining: Powering 3.3kV ventilation fans deep underground where ventilation is limited and fire smoke is fatal.
  • Refinery Drives: Serving as a dedicated feed for large Variable Frequency Drives (VFDs) in hazardous zones (Zone 2) where oil-filled equipment is prohibited.

Electrical and Mechanical Data

Technical ParameterSpecification Data
Rated Power3000 kVA (3 MVA)
Primary Voltage10kV / 11kV / 33kV / 35kV
Secondary Voltage690V / 3.3kV / 6.6kV (Recommended)
Rated Current~2510 A (at 690V) / ~262 A (at 6.6kV)
ClassificationDry power transformer
Impedance Voltage7.0% - 8.0% (High Z to limit fault kA)
Insulation ClassClass F (155°C) or Class H (180°C)
CoolingAN (Base) / AF (Forced Air)
PD Level≤ 10 pC (Per IEC 60076-11)
Total WeightApprox. 7,500 - 8,800 kg
